ABSTRACT

Background: Schizophrenia is one of the most distressing central nervous system (CNS) disorders. It is described by positive, negative and cognitive symptoms. These symptoms can be controlled by the antipsychotic medicines. The numerous antipsychotic medications used today are not lacking the adverse drug reactions. The Withania coagulans a susceptible species, is not explored much for its CNS effects except in late seventies. Therefore, it was thought worthwhile to investigate anti-psychotic activities of alcoholic extract of Withania coagulans fruits. The objective of the present study was to assess the antipsychotic activity of alcoholic extract of Withania coagulans fruits in Swiss albino mice by Cook’s Pole Climb Apparatus for conditioned avoidance response (CAR)Methods: Cook’s Pole Climb Apparatus for conditioned avoidance response was used for assessing the antipsychotic activity of the alcoholic extract of 200mg/kg, 500mg/kg and 1000mg/kg doses of Withania coagulans fruits.Results: There was statistically (p-value >0.05) no significant association between any of the 200mg/kg, 500mg/kg and 1000mg/kg doses of the alcoholic extracts of Withania coagulans fruits with antipsychotic activity in Swiss albino mice.Conclusions: Withania coagulans fruits alcoholic extract did not demonstrate antipsychotic activity in Swiss albino mice under standard conditions.

ABSTRACT

Adverse drug reactions (ADRs) are a major cause of morbidity and mortality in countries having limited healthcare resources. Of all the Adverse Drug Reactions, antimicrobials contribute 28% which is highest compared to the other drugs. Ofloxacin is an antimicrobial used for treating several bacterial infections. Incidence rate of adverse drug reactions (ADRs) to ofloxacin is 4.27%. Although these figures appear to be small, it is consumed for gastrointestinal infections along with ornidazole in India contributing significant burden of ADRs. However, there is no research done in past many years focusing on the adverse drug reactions of ofloxacin. This article bridges the gap of such a need. The objective of the present study was to review the adverse drug reactions related to ofloxacin in human and animal studies. Authors conducted Pubmed and Cochrane library search to review all the articles related to the adverse drug reaction of ofloxacin from 1980 to 2016. Authors got 84 articles pertaining to the adverse drug reactions of ofloxacin. Authors conclude that ofloxacin should be judiciously used as the side effect profile is increasing.
